  5. Hi @Symbiosis I'll let others say how they find it, but Sign In Apps recommended method of running an evacuation process is to use our free companion app or using the kiosks. Each device can join a 'Shared evacuation', meaning that they are all synchronised, so if someone is marked as present on one device, it displays this on all devices in the evacuation. You can filter the list live by Group, Fire evacuation point or any other personal field like year group. You can create or sync as many tags as you want and filter by these. With a compatible MIS, we can also pull the school register and add it to the list along with visitors, staff and contractors.

  7. Sign In App now have the ability to protect any attendance codes from being overwritten. In the example where a pupil has an 'M' mark due to an authorised medical appointment, when configured, we detect this when the pupil later signs in and prevent the code being replaced by 'L' or 'U'. We also have an option for custom writeback codes based on the answer to a question (for example: Reason for being late or :Reason for leaving early) Anyone who would like to know more or have this configured, please reach out to our support team.
  8. Thanks @steveg Yes, indeed we do support pupil registers in evacuations via our Wonde sync with compatible MIS. When an authorised user selects the evacuate button in our portal, reception kiosk or our free 'Companion app' for mobile devices, we not only list everyone who has signed in today on the evacuation list (Staff, visitors, contractors etc), but we pull a copy of the register and populate the list with everyone who is currently in the building. As we are a cloud based solution, there is no concern if there is a power outage at any point during the evacuation.
